A Serangoon Executive Flat Just Sold For A Record $1,270,000 — By The Slimmest Of Margins
The sale of an Executive flat at 232A Serangoon Avenue 2 has set a record resale price for a flat of this type in Serangoon. The 1,507 sq ft unit, between the 10th and 12th floors, changed hands for $1.27 million ($843 psf) when it was sold last week.
